Indonesian Phrasebook and Dictionary by Lonely Planet. Indonesian, or Bahasa Indonesia as it is known to the locals is the official language of the Republic of Indonesia. Indonesian and its closest relative Malay, both developed from Old Malay, an Austronesian language spoken in the kingdom of Srivijaya on the island of Sumatra.
